i.meller: Good to know you would be visiting Dubai. Well, as for accommodation, you would want to stay close to the metro. You get to spend less on transportation if you use the metro. Ensure your hotel is close to a metro station. When you get to Dubai, you can get the metro cards at any station and use to visit any of the malls. The metro saves you on a lot. As for places to visit, you can visit the malls (Dubai Mall, Mall of the Emirates, Dubai Marina Mall, Ibn Battuta Mall, etc). There might be a tour agency attached to your hotel so you can also book for a city tour (it might be cheaper to hire a taxi and negotiate with the driver considering you are going with family). Whatever you do, do not miss Ski Dubai at Mall of the Emirates! Itz a fantastic experience. The Desert Safari tour is also a WOW experience but might not be advisable for kids (the rides could get really bumpy in the desert). You may also visit the Atlantis(The Lost Chambers) which is close to the beach too. Your kids would sure love this! For shopping, you may want to shop in Deira (things are cheaper in this area) but as someone rightly advised, avoid Nigerians hanging around. If you choose to shop in malls, then be ready to spend. Things are quite cheap in Deira and you can also get quality stuff there too. If you want to have extra fun, you can visit Ferrari World in Abu Dhabi. Having fun in Dubai is all about how much you are willing to spend. Dubai is a beautiful place. You sure will enjoy your trip. |

I will advise you to first take the big bus tour of dubai the starting point is at the deira city centre you can also buy your desert safari from them as well as the wild wadi water park at a much discounted price. For african food you can visit afican home restaurant at the mezanine floor al hili hotel on al sabka road deira they also have a branch near california hotel naif deira. Also visit dragon mart at the international city is a chinese mall with very cheap goods Also visit the karama market for cheap designer replica that most boutiques in Nigeria sell. As some said please don't trust any Nigerian hustlers in dubai most of them are cheats rather trust the indians etc 1 Like |

You can buy Du lines anywhere all you need is your intl passport, they are more expensive at the airport so better buy it outside airport In addition pls ignore some marketers at the airport that will invite you to an event and promising you a safari, it is a waste of time unless you want to invest with them,the safari promised is also not the usual jolly one . Take train it will help you reduce cost but as a stranger you don't have a choice but to use taxi which is expensive. But after getting to know your location you can take the metro. |
